Warner Music Group and Internet Media Services Partner to Accelerate Digital Advertising Opportunities in Emerging Markets

July 3, 2018

IMS Will Manage Advertising Inventory Across All WMG’s YouTube Channels in Russia, Poland, Spain, Portugal, and Most of Latin America

Internet Media Services (IMS), the leading digital marketing and communications company, and Warner Music Group (WMG) have entered a strategic partnership to create and promote new advertising opportunities in emerging markets across the globe. IMS will manage the advertising inventory for WMG’s YouTube channels in Russia, Poland, Spain, Portugal, and all of Latin America, with the exception of Brazil. These channels, featuring content from WMG’s vast roster of global artists, present previously untapped potential for new advertising clients. 

Gastón Taratuta, CEO and Founder of IMS said: “IMS is committed to providing better solutions to advertisers, with a focus on brand safety and quality in our work. We are delighted to partner with Warner Music, and appreciate the confidence that they’ve placed in IMS to grow operations in these fast-growing regions.”

Alfonso Perez Soto, Senior Vice President, Global Business Development/Chief Commercial Officer, Emerging Markets, WMG, said: “With music traveling faster and farther than ever before, emerging markets present a real opportunity to connect artists, fans, and brands. IMS is a leader in developing unique marketing strategies and we’re pleased to partner with them as we ramp up our global advertising offerings.” 

With this agreement, IMS continues to develop its robust product portfolio with operations throughout Latin America, Europe and Asia. In partnering with a content provider like WMG, IMS adds to its services the potential opportunity for advertisers to develop unique digital campaigns and brand integrations, on a global scale.
